LED technology made in Germany
When developing our LED systems every tiny little detail was important to us. All the components including the housing, the thermo-elements and the electronics board – the heart of each TESZLA – was made by us in Germany. Fully automated board assembly and robot-controlled manufacture allow for competitive production whilst, at the same time, ensuring extremely high manufacturing quality and construction precision.
Every TESZLA light is equipped with a micro-controller which monitors the internal operational temperature of the LED. Once a predetermined temperature has been reached, an integrated fan is turned on. The speed of this fan is adjusted depending on the heat generation. This ensures that every light can always work under optimal conditions and will not be damaged due to overheating.
Fascinating light output
The selection and assembly of the light boards alone prove that the TESZLA series features the most up-to-date technology. Every group of lights is controlled its own output driver. All the driver circuits are controlled via an ultra-modern processor which monitors all lighting and operational parameters so as to ensure constant colour and light values.
Thanks to the latest XLamp(R) XM-L High-Voltage LED from CREE, the system uses less electricity and provides an impressive amount of light. Every board features a combination of CREE XM-L white LEDs, CREE XP-G blue and royal blue LEDs as well as two special LEDs – the entire output is 66 Watts.
With regard to the optics we avoided using additional lenses as this means that a lot of the light output is lost. TESZLA is therefore equipped with a loss-free 120° lens which provides the aquarium with the entire amount of light emitted.
Contrary to many other lighting systems with lenses, there is no danger of coral being bleached by concentrated beams.
GIESEMANN’S many years of experience come into play when developing this light and when defining the light distribution. Integrated mirrors reflect all light beams onto the surface to be illuminated and thus guarantee perfect lighting.
Fully automated lighting program
We constructed TESZLA so that it only requires a few programming steps to enable the perfect light simulation throughout the day.
The board features 4 differently assembled circuits with a total of 20 LEDs which are separated into three groups for individual programming. Select the desired light output for each colour group to create your personal mix of colours. Once you have confirmed the colour selection, the light will automatically start with the sunrise cycle and regulates the system at predefined times turning the desired light output up and down as required. During the night phase a moonlight simulation kicks in using the royal blue LED on a reduced setting.
In addition to this, each TESZLA light features an interface to your existing aquarium computer thus making it possible to control each individual group of lights externally. This means that numerous lighting scenarios can be implemented depending on your computer.

FAQ.
What size area does a single fixture cover?
The footprint depends on the height above the water surface. We developed our TESZLA series with wide focus optics for the best light output. We recomend a light intensive area of 17 x 17 inch by placing the fixture close to the water.
Your intensity chart makes it looks like a single fixture will cover a 4 ft tank. Is that correct?
No. The chart is not intended to show how large an area the fixture will cover but rather the light intensity of several monitoring points. The chart indicates the total area measured including the areas with a lower intensity.

Can this fixture be used for a freshwater planted aquarium?
The LED board contains LEDs with a blue-heavy spectrum. We do not recomend this for freshwater aquariums containing plants. We are working on LEDs for both emersal and submersal plants, but up to now we have not been satisfied with the available blend of LEDs.
What type of testing has your LED fixture under gone?
The lights and LED boards have been running for 28 months under real and artificial conditions without any technical problems. Performance data is logged daily by our engineers for all of our test fixtures. We have used and tested about 120 boards and fixtures during that time.
GIESEMANN is the only company worldwide with certified aquarium fixtures meeting the very strict rules of the TUV institute. Before a fixture gets the TUV certificate, the complete manufacturing process and the company needs to be certified. During the approval process 25 fixtures are tested in several ways. Overheating in 60°C (140°F) for 21 days, Salt spray chamber for 4 weeks, 5000 Volt overvoltage etc. – All 25 units need to work after this time. In addition, the independent TUV engineers visit twice a year and randomly select 5 units of each model for additional testing.
What replacement components are available?
For our registered products we offer a full service warranty of 24 months. If any failure occurs within the first 2 years, we change the complete product. Our fixture is design so the whole LED board can be replaced. We will not ask customers to replace single LEDs by opening the fixtures and repairing it themselves.
LEDs in all fixtures are connected in a series connection. Many simple fixtures have just a mains adaptor for all LEDs (same as fairy lights). Others have a driver which supports up to 12 LEDs together.
If one LED fails all other LEDs in this circuit will be overdriven by a higher voltage. In those circumstances it is usually just a question of some hours and all other LED in this circuit will be damaged too.
In other words, just changing single LEDs is not good solution. There is also the risk of damaging the complete electronics with a static electricity charge when replacing single LEDs.
Some companies state that their fixture can be upgraded at any time with a new generation of LEDs however it is not possible to run stronger or different LEDs in the future without changing the controlling electronics. Each new LED generation also needs different driving and processing components.
For these reasons we believe it is more appropriate to offer a replacement of the complete board, with the benefit of getting 20 fresh new LEDS and brand new electronics.
All parts on all GIESEMANN fixtures are available as replacement. For our fixtures we guarantee replacement parts for 10 years after purchase.
